Lot Description

A platinum diamond and enamel dress ring. The brilliant-cut diamond collet within a black enamel surround, inset with scattered brilliant-cut diamonds. Estimated total diamond weight 0.70ct. Hallmarks for London, 1982.

Overall condition good. Minor surface wear in keeping with general wear. The central collet is not fully soldered together. The diamonds are bright, lively and well matched. Light nicks and chips can be seen to some. Fine feathers and fractures can be seen under magnification. Individual size and setting prevents accurate colour and clarity assessment. Ring size N.
